At the end of the series the last race is always a four-hour Enduro. For $25 Parma gives us a car in parts in a bag with two sets of Tuna tires. They name a specific body that we all paint and run. This year was a bit different and Steve custom-painted eight bodies, all with flames. They looked great! And the Series supplies two motors from the GT1 handout motor class to complete the package.
Now here's where it gets interesting. It's a mystery as to what chassis you'll be racing until you crack open the box and hand them out at race time.
You have onr hour to build the car, get it on the track, and then race it for four hours. Pretty cool concept. And it's a NOTHING but Fun day!!

Fifteen minutes a lane thru all eight lanes, one minute to move the car and controller plus switch drivers for the two-hour first half. An hour lunch and then back to run the second half the same as the first.
No working on the car except when the power is on!! No Ttack calls!! And 20 racers hootin', hollerin', and having a great time.
Here are the results:
At the end we had two ties among four teams and both decided by five sections. Amazing it all came down to 20 feet after almost 3,000 laps and four hours of racing. Can't get much better than that in my humble opinion.
Team FO - 3,033 laps
Team J&B - 2,934.16
Team Canrac - 2,934.11
Team Rt. 93 - 2,790. 9
Team Whatt - 2,790.4
Team Dirty White Boys - 2,644
Team EMR - 2,628
Team Smith 0 (catastrophic failure starting with the drive in to missing essential items for the build). Sorry for the problems but Rich said they'll be back next year and get right after it again!!
